Once you hold your TEFL certification, these are the primary environments where online English teachers build their careers.
Platforms like italki, Preply, and Cambly connect you directly with students. You set your own profile, rate, and availability. Students book you, pay the platform, and you receive your cut.
Platforms like GoGoKid and Magic Ears connect TEFL-certified teachers with young learners in China, Japan, and South Korea. Lesson plans are provided, classes are 25–40 minutes, and student supply is enormous.
Companies worldwide hire online TEFL-certified teachers to deliver English training to their employees. Business English online commands the highest rates — especially for IELTS coaching, presentation skills, and writing.
The ultimate destination — build your own student base via social media, a personal website, or word of mouth. No platform cuts. You keep 100% of your earnings and own your teaching business entirely.

The barrier to entry for online English teaching is genuinely low. Here's what you actually need — and what you don't.
A 120-hour accredited online TEFL course is the essential foundation. Required by all major platforms and highly valued by students who compare teacher credentials before booking.
Any modern computer capable of running video conferencing. A dedicated machine is worth it — your classroom is your screen.
Crystal clear audio is non-negotiable. Students cite audio quality as the top factor in teacher satisfaction. A £40–£80 USB headset is all you need.
Many laptops have decent built-in cameras, but a dedicated 1080p webcam at around £50–£80 makes a significant visual difference to your professional appearance.
At minimum 10Mbps upload speed. A wired ethernet connection is preferable to Wi-Fi for stability during live lessons — vital for a professional online teaching experience.
A tidy, uncluttered background or a simple virtual background signals professionalism. Good lighting (a ring light costs under £30) transforms your on-screen appearance dramatically.

A TEFL (Teaching English as a Foreign Language) certification is the universal standard recognised by language schools, tutoring platforms, and private students worldwide. Unlike a PGCE or QTS (UK teaching qualification), TEFL is specifically designed for teaching English to non-native speakers — making it the ideal qualification for online English teaching careers.
It depends on your rate and niche. At $40/hr and 25 teaching hours per week, you'd earn $4,000/month. Many online TEFL teachers work 20–30 hours of actual teaching plus lesson preparation, making it genuinely manageable as a full-time career. Group classes and digital products allow you to earn more while teaching fewer hours.
No — and in fact, most TEFL methodology strongly advocates the English-only approach in lessons. You don't need to speak your students' language. Your TEFL certification will teach you how to explain concepts, demonstrate grammar, and create understanding through English-only immersive instruction.
